Accession
GO:0070960
Name
positive regulation of neutrophil mediated cytotoxicity
Ontology
biological_process
Synonyms
positive regulation of neutrophil mediated cell killing, up regulation of neutrophil mediated cytotoxicity, up-regulation of neutrophil mediated cytotoxicity, upregulation of neutrophil mediated cytotoxicity, activation of neutrophil mediated cytotoxicity, stimulation of neutrophil mediated cytotoxicity
Alternate IDs
None
Definition
Any process that increases the frequency, rate or extent of the directed killing of a target cell by a neutrophil. Source: GOC:add, GOC:mah
